Why London Strikes Yemen: UK Foreign Office Explains

The United Kingdom has participated in strikes against the ‘Ansar Allah’ (Houthi) movement in northern and central Yemen, in cooperation with the United States, aimed at ensuring the safety of its ships and freedom of navigation in the Red Sea. This was announced by UK Foreign Secretary David Cameron on his social media page.

“The safety of British vessels and freedom of navigation in the Red Sea are of paramount importance, which is why we are taking action,” he wrote.

Previously, a member of the Houthi movement's Supreme Political Council, Mohammed Ali al-Houthi, stated that the strikes from Washington and London towards Yemen have become “terrorist barbarism and premeditated aggression.” Earlier, the US had accused Iran of preparing attacks on commercial vessels by Houthis in the Red Sea.
